The frequency at which a star's intensity is greatest depends directly on its temperature. The hotter the star, the higher the frequency (and shorter the wavelength) at which its intensity peaks, as described by Wien's Law.
The frequency, intensity, time, and type (FITT) formula is a framework used in exercise science to design and modify fitness programs. It stands for Frequency (how often you exercise per week), Intensity (how hard you exercise), Time (how long each session lasts), and Type (the specific activities you engage in). Adhering to these principles can help individuals tailor their workouts to meet their fitness goals effectively.

Receptors provide information about the intensity of a stimulus through the frequency of action potentials they generate. Higher intensity stimuli result in higher frequency of action potentials being sent to the brain, signaling a stronger stimulus. This frequency coding allows the brain to interpret the intensity of stimuli.
